Washington, April 27 -- Congressman Brendan F. Boyle issued the following press release:

Congressman Brendan F. Boyle (PA-02) today joined physicians, advocates, and patients at Fox Chase Cancer Center in Northeast Philadelphia to mark the unanimous House passage of his bipartisan Women and Lung Cancer Research and Preventive Services Act (https://boyle.house.gov/media-center/press-releases/boyle-fitzpatrick-applaud-house-passing-their-bill-study-and-prevent) and call on the Senate to swiftly take up the legislation. Lung cancer remains the leading cause of cancer-related death among women in the United States, even as overall cancer rates have declined.
